Daryl Hall’s lawsuit against music partner John Oates may have shocked fans, but the pair have made it clear through the years that they aren’t best friends — to put it mildly.“John and I are brothers, but we are not creative brothers,” Hall declared during an interview on the “Club Random with Bill Maher” podcast in December 2022.“We are business partners.
We made records called Hall & Oates together, but we’ve always been very separate, and that’s a really important thing for me,” he added.The musician also implied that he did most of the work, noting that their 1980 song “Kiss on My List” doesn’t list Oates as a songwriter.Earlier this month, Hall and his organization, the Daryl Hall Revocable Trust, filed a lawsuit against Oates and Oates’ trust, the John W.
Oates TISA Trust and its co-trustees in Davidson County Chancery Court.Additionally, the court issued a temporary restraining order to begin Nov.
30.The documents, which were filed on Nov. 16 in Nashville, Tennessee, are labeled as relating to a “contract/debt” suit and are currently sealed.
